The Denver Nuggets (13-7) clash with the Los Angeles Lakers (11-8) at the Pepsi Center. The game starts at 9 p.m. ET on Tuesday, November 27, 2018, and will air on NBATV.

Denver opened as a 4-point favorite, while the game’s Over/Under (O/U) has been set at 215 points.

Los Angeles Lakers vs. Denver Nuggets Betting Prediction

In the Lakers’ last contest, they were 7.5-point favorites and were defeated by the Orlando Magic, 108-104. The total points for the game (212) finished under the projected point total of 216. Orlando’s offensive rebounding percentage was their biggest strength over Los Angeles. The Magic had a rate of 19.6 (below their season average of 20.8), while the Lakers posted a mark of 12.2 (below their season average of 23.2). LeBron James led Los Angeles in scoring with 24 points on 8-for-14 shooting.

The Nuggets were victorious over the Oklahoma City Thunder in their last game, 105-98, despite being 6-point underdogs. The game’s combined points (203) came in under the projected point total of 217. Denver’s free throw rate was their largest strength over Oklahoma City. The Nuggets had a rate of 0.179 (matching their season average), while the Thunder posted a mark of 0.146 (below their season average of 0.192). Jamal Murray was Denver’s leading scorer with 22 points on 9-for-23 shooting from the field.

This is the second game of the season between these two teams. James recorded 28 points, 11 rebounds and 11 assists in the first matchup, in which the Lakers defeated the Nuggets 121-114, covering as 1-point underdogs. The game finished with a total of 235 points, which was just 0.5 points above the projected point total of 234.5 points. The Lakers had a better turnover percentage (11.3 vs. 15.9) and had a better free throw rate (0.207 vs. 0.174).

Los Angeles comes into the game with records of 11-8 straight up (SU) and 7-12 against the spread (ATS). Vegas is known to set the total high when the Lakers are involved, as 57.9 percent of their contests have gone under the O/U total.

Meanwhile, Denver is 13-7 SU and 11-9 ATS. Similarly to Los Angeles, games involving the Nuggets also have a tendency to go under the projected point total (65.0 percent).

Expect Denver to own the offensive glass in this battle. The Nuggets currently rank third in offensive rebounding percentage (27.1 percent), while Los Angeles ranks 23rd in defensive rebounding percentage (75.2 percent). Contrasting tempos will be on display in this battle. The up-tempo Lakers rank third in possessions per game, while the slower-paced Nuggets rank 24th.
